Harlequin, Scaramouch, Pantalone, and other beloved figures
from the Commedia dell'Arte grace the pages of this rare and
delightful work. These magnificent engravings were originally
published in 1716 in Nuremberg. Little is known of the author,
save that he was a Venetian ballet master; his work bespeaks
his prodigious gifts of imagination and creativity. More than
100 full-page plates depict a variety of themes, and each
features a short passage of musical accompaniment and
hand-lettered German captions (with English translations). The
author states the theme and air for each dance and offers
suggestions for steps; the handsome engravings convey the
highly atmospheric settings and costumes. Approximately 103
b/w illustrations.
